Skip to content

Commit 3285467

Browse files
committed
[ci] Fix cpp-unit-tests Job
1 parent ac1e018 commit 3285467

File tree

1 file changed

+5
-5
lines changed

1 file changed

+5
-5
lines changed

.github/workflows/tests.yml

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-42,14 +42,14 @@ jobs:
4242
cpp-unit-tests:
4343
if: github.event.pull_request.draft == false
4444
runs-on: ubuntu-24.04
45-
container:
46-
image: ghcr.io/faasm/accless-experiments:0.8.1
4745
steps:
4846
- name: "Checkout code"
4947
uses: actions/checkout@v4
5048
- name: "Build C++ code"
51-
run: python3 build.py
49+
run: |
50+
./scripts/accli_wrapper.sh docker run --mount --cwd /code/accless/accless python3 build.py
5251
working-directory: accless
52+
shell: bash
5353
- name: "Run C++ unit tests"
54-
run: ctest
55-
working-directory: accless/build-native
54+
run: |
55+
./scripts/accli_wrapper.sh docker run --mount --cwd /code/accless/accless/build-native ctest -- --output-on-failure

0 commit comments

Comments
 (0)